Understanding CPR: A Short Overview

Before diving right into the comparison of course formats, it's necessary to comprehend what CPR involves. Cardiopulmonary resuscitation is an emergency situation treatment that incorporates chest compressions and artificial air flow to keep blood circulation and oxygenation throughout cardiac arrest or breathing failure.

What Does CPR Stand For?

CPR represents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ation. It intends to bring back regular heart rhythm via hands-on intervention up until expert medical help arrives.

Pros of Online CPR Courses

Flexibility

One considerable advantage of on-line programs is flexibility. Learners can select when and where they want to examine without needing to stick to a stringent schedule.

Accessibility

On-line courses can be accessed from anywhere with a net link. This is specifically valuable for those staying in remote areas or with restricted accessibility to physical training centers.

Cost-Effectiveness

Often, online training courses are less expensive than their in-person counterparts due to reduced overhead costs connected with maintaining physical classrooms.

Self-Paced Learning

Trainees have the capacity to discover at their very own speed-- reviewing materials several times if required before attempting assessments.

Variety of Resources

Several on-line programs supply a selection of understanding tools consisting of video clips showing methods like DRSABCD (Threat, Feedback, Send for help, Respiratory tract, Breathing, Blood Circulation).

Convenience

Getting rid of travel time saves both money and time; you can finish your training from the convenience of your home.

Cons of Online CPR Courses

Limited Hands-On Practice

While theory can be found out online effectively, exercising lifesaving techniques requires hands-on experience that might not be sufficiently covered without supervision.

Less Immediate Feedback

On the internet training courses might do not have real-time interaction with teachers who can supply prompt comments on method execution.

Motivation Levels

Self-discipline is required for on the internet knowing; some people might struggle to remain encouraged without a structured class environment.

Technical Issues

Reliance on innovation suggests possible problems like poor web connectivity could prevent finding out experiences.

Certification Validity

Not all employers recognize certifications gotten with on-line systems as comparable to those acquired with conventional methods.

Pros of In-Person CPR Courses

Hands-On Experience

The primary benefit is the chance for straight method under professional support-- a necessary component for understanding methods like chest compressions or rescue breaths on a newborn or adult manikin.

Immediate Instructor Feedback

Learners receive punctual responses on their efficiency from trainers who can fix mistakes in real-time.

Structured Environment

The class setup cultivates a regimented technique in the direction of learning while offering an interesting ambience with peers.

Networking Opportunities

Going to classes enables you to connect with various other people interested in healthcare or emergency action training-- potentially causing future collaborations.

Enhanced Focus Levels

Being physically existing decreases disturbances compared to researching in your home where interruptions might take place frequently.

Accredited Certification Options

Numerous companies use across the country acknowledged qualifications after finishing their programs-- important credentials for possible employers requiring first aid qualifications.

Cons of In-Person CPR Courses

Fixed Set up Requirements

Classes are usually arranged at specific times; this can contravene other dedications making it less practical compared to adaptable on-line options.

Travel Costs & Time Consumption

Commuting adds added expenses (fuel/transport) along with lost time traveling back-and-forth from course locations.

Limited Schedule Naturally Near You

Relying on geographic location some may discover less offered choices nearby-- triggering longer journeys simply for training.
